    Lightbulb Headlight retainer fix...

    If you haven't seen the little metal retainers that come with the FFR headlight set you won't believe how weak they are. They just are not up to the task. I have seen another fix that required bending up some new retainers and even a mention of silicone to hold them steady. What ever works for you. I had had enough of the bendy little rascals so it was time to take them out. A little scrap aluminum and a few minutes on a bandsaw and its problem gone. The photos should be enough to get you going on your own fix.

    I stiffened my headlight mounting brackets by simply cutting out pieces of heavier aluminum sheet (the same gauge as used for the cockpit panels), and drilling them in the same relative location. This provided a stiffening backup for each retaining clip, and I have had no problems at all since.
